I encountered the following error when installing gcamwrapper on Windows with pip install .. It seems Windows does not support os.uname.

Processing c:\workspace\github\gcamwrapper
  Preparing metadata (setup.py) ... error
  error: subprocess-exited-with-error

  × python setup.py egg_info did not run successfully.
  │ exit code: 1
  ╰─> [7 lines of output]
      Traceback (most recent call last):
        File "<string>", line 2, in <module>
        File "<pip-setuptools-caller>", line 34, in <module>
        File "C:\WorkSpace\github\gcamwrapper\setup.py", line 24, in <module>
          JAVA_PLATFORM_INCLUDE = JAVA_INCLUDE + '/' + os.uname()[0].lower()
                                                       ^^^^^^^^
      AttributeError: module 'os' has no attribute 'uname'. Did you mean: 'name'?
      [end of output]

  note: This error originates from a subprocess, and is likely not a problem with pip.
error: metadata-generation-failed

× Encountered error while generating package metadata.
╰─> See above for output.
